Browse the day away at Chatuchak Weekend Market, a popular covered retail space in the city center. Attracting over 200,000 visitors on a typical weekend, the huge market offers 27 separate areas of stalls, with over 8,000 individual vendors plying their trade. From collectibles, souvenirs, and clothes, to fresh food, restaurants, and household appliance stores, the market contains a mind-boggling range of products. Its sheer scale will likely impress even those who have nothing on their shopping list. This place is one of the biggest market in Thailand. I came here several times and I have to say, they have everything there. They have all sort of items from clothing to food which are usually aimed for younger people. Most of the items are very cheap and are good value for the price. When I go there, I like to go buy vintage style shirt and eats some of the delicious snacks that people sells along the way. However, it is in the middle of the sun meaning that it's gonna be very hot and you will have to walk quite a distance to cover the whole market, so it is best to prepare a hat or an umbrella when coming to the market.
